Observed Avalanches

Did you observe any avalanches? 
Yes
Avalanche Type:
Hard Slab
Size:
Size 3: Could bury and destroy a car, damage a truck, destroy a wood frame house, or break a few trees
Elevation:
Aspect:
SE
Comments:
Propagated full feature and ran full path destroying substantial forest in the valley floor.

Observations

All of the following avalanches were naturals today:

SE aspect of Cement Basin ~6400’ D2 at approx. 11am today.

SE aspect of Bluebell (“Big Daddy” run) ~6400’ D3.5 at approx. noon today.

Numerous Dry Loose size 1 on multiple aspects.
